Problem
Existing printing systems face challenges with excessive worker workload due to long carrying distances and large floor area requirements, which hinder high-density layout and flexible expansion of printing lines.
Innovation Solution
A printing system with a direction changing unit that allows for duplex and simplex printing modes, where sheets are introduced and output in parallel lines with adjacent input and output units, reducing carrying distances and optimizing workspace layout.

In a printing system capable of selectively performing duplex printing and simplex printing, a first input unit and a second input unit are adjacent to each other. A first output unit and a second output unit are adjacent to each other. In duplex printing, a sheet supplied from the first input unit is printed on a first side thereof in a first printing apparatus and the traveling direction thereof is changed at a changing unit while the sheet is reversed, and then the sheet is printed on a second side thereof in a second printing apparatus and output to the second output unit. In simplex printing, a sheet supplied from the first or second input unit is printed on one side thereof and the traveling direction thereof is changed at the changing unit, and then the sheet is output to the first or second output unit.
